Explore More! https://www.instagram.com/betweensunandsea & Please SUBSCRIBE: https://www.youtube.com/c/betweensunandsea After sailing from Big Sand Cay to la Republica Dominicana (Dominican Republic) we hunkered down for hurricane season in Luperon. In this well protected anchorage we met an amazing cruising community and traveled as much as we could. Every day here can be filled with exploring hidden beaches, beautiful vistas on the mountains above, and blow holes on abandoned resorts, that shoot waves right into the sky! Check out the some of the best things to do in and around this well protected hurricane hole and meet some of the crazy fun cruisers/sailors/pirates we adventured with during hurricane season. We also took a trip to Alex's Peace Corps site on the east coast, and made pit stops to provision in Santo Domingo and Santiago along the way.
